What Is 401(k) Law?

For many American workers, a 401(k) is the most common type of retirement savings and investment account. Beyond your contributions, your employer and plan administrators owe you a fiduciary duty to be responsible stewards of your investments. Poorly and irresponsibly managed plans could leave them liable for significant losses.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Securities Lawyer To Help With a 401(k)?

If you invest in a 401(k) offered by your employer, you may not have much need for a lawyer’s help, unless you notice signs of mismanagement on the part of your employer or plan manager. These can include:

  • Not diversifying investments to minimize risk
  • Not following plan requirements
  • Not disclosing conflicts of interest
  • Failing to monitor investment performance
  • Failing to perform timely plan management

How Can a Securities Lawyer Help Me?

A securities lawyer can review your case and explain your legal options. Your lawyer can file a claim against a company for a breach of fiduciary duty that puts your investment at risk. Your securities lawyer can help you recover damages in a securities violation lawsuit. Damages that you might be able to win in a securities case can include:

  • Out-of-pocket losses
  • Aggregate damages
  • Attorney fees
